About This Item
1798. hardcover. good. To which is added, an Historical Survey of the French Colony in the Island of St. Domingo. Abridged Edition. Folding map of the West Indies and Central America. xvi, 373pp. + 7pp. of publisher's ads. 8vo, original tree calf with elaborately gilt spine; (front cover detached, spine ends and corners worn, some light foxing, not affecting map). London: B. Crosby, 1798.<br/><br/> "A classic in British Caribbean literature and probably the most famous work in the field. Standard for over a century, and still in many respects the best book on the subject up to the close of the eighteenth century...(Edward's) book is written from the point of view of a planter, unrestricted of the slave trade. Of immeasurable value for contemporary conditions, showing the state of affairs after the American war and before the abolition of the traffic in blacks." Ragatz, p. 165.<br/><br/>
